I would like a little more information about your camera settings, not particularly f stop and time so much as Camera used and mode (Aperture Priority, Shutter Priority, Manual, Auto, Program etc.) and why you chose that mode for that shoot. I'll be watching for your next video with eager anticipation. Happy New Year and may all your aspirations reach fruition.

    • @JimNix
      @JimNix  Před 7 měsíci +1

      Thanks for following along, I appreciate that. As far as shooting modes go, I use Aperture a large majority of the time. But for long exposures (waterfalls, light trails, etc) then I use Manual. I started out using Aperture so it's my default mode (and I use it exclusively when shooting brackets for HDR), and for a lot of shots I am not too concerned about how many fractions of a second the shot is, bc it doesn't matter (except when it does). But for long exposures with silky smooth water, it's Manual all the way bc exposure time does matter for me then. Hope that helps and thanks!
